T-Mobile Voicemail
Step 1
Hold down the "1" key on the cellphone to access voicemail. Alternatively, you may call the number "123" to access voicemail as well.

Step 2
Press the "3" key to access the greeting settings in the voicemail menu.
Step 3
Follow the voice instructions given to you to record a new voicemail greeting.
Verizon Wireless Voicemail
Step 1
Dial "*86" and press the "Send" key to access the voicemail menu.
Step 2
Press "4" while in the voicemail menu to access the personal options menu.
Step 3
Press "3" while in the personal options menu to access the voicemail greeting menu.
Step 4
Press "1" while in the voicemail greeting menu to record a new voicemail greeting message.
Step 5
Follow the voice prompts to record and save your new voicemail greeting message.
AT&T Voicemail
Step 1
Dial "1-888-288-8893." When you hear your voicemail message play, press the " * " key to access voicemail.
Step 2
Press "3" to access the greetings menu from the general voicemail menu.
Step 3
Press "1" to record a personal greeting.
Step 4
Press "1" after you are finished recording your new greeting to save it, or press "2" to record another one. You may also press " * " to return to the main menu.
